Cary Street Partners's Q1 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2025, Cary Street Partners held 910 positions worth $3.16B, up 2.8% from $3.07B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 20% of the portfolio.

Cary Street Partners deployed $163M of net new capital in Q1 2025, opening 81 new positions and adding to 285 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was First Eagle Global Equity ETF: 232,182 shares worth $8.72M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 13% of assets, down from 14%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was State Street SPDR Portfolio S&P 500 Growth ETF, an estimated $23M trimmed.
